Toilet Paper
The single most requested product by Box Divvy Hubsters and members: loo paper. And if our goal is to keep our members out of supermarkets, then this category is a ‘must-have’.
About A Dog
The toilet paper is produced by a small Sydney-based company called About A Dog. It was born during Covid (most of their business was in hospitality which closed during lockdowns), and it took off. The quality of the paper is second to none in our view, and this is not hyperbole: it’s better than the mainstream brands like Quilton, Kleenex and Sorbent. It’s also a notch about Who Gives A Crap. Of course, when it comes to loo paper, all opinions are subjective – so this week we will send some sample rolls to each participating Hub so you and your members can judge for yourselves. For online reviews, check out their website: 93% is 5-star)
About A Dog has a few other features:
• It’s 100% recycled – and certified by the FSC (Forest Stewardship Council).
• The paper is Ink, Chlorine and BPA free.
• It’s made locally in Milperra, Sydney – but the raw material (pulp) is imported. (Who Gives a Crap is manufactured in China).
• 50% of profits are donated to animal shelters including Sydney Dogs and Cats Home, Maggie’s Rescue, Greyt Greys Victorian Greyhound Rescue and Pets of the Homeless Australia to name just a few. To date, over $46,000 has been donated.
The product itself is a double-length roll with 360 sheets, and available as a box of 24 rolls. It costs $31.65 – which works out to $1.32 per roll.
Below is a price comparison per 100 sheets (using 3 ply 100% recycled paper):
Of all the 3-ply, 100% recycled toilet paper, About A Dog is the cheapest. (You can get cheaper Kleenex paper but not recycled. Sorbent doesn’t use recycled paper at all).
